What is Lensa AI?

Lensa AI is a mobile application developed by Prisma Labs, a company renowned for its innovative AI-powered image editing tools. The app utilizes advanced machine learning algorithms to analyze user-submitted selfies and generate stylized portraits in various artistic styles. With its user-friendly interface and impressive results, Lensa AI has garnered millions of downloads, becoming a viral sensation on social media platforms.

The NSFW Controversy

Despite its initial success, Lensa AI has recently faced scrutiny due to reports of the app generating NSFW content. Users have shared instances where the AI-generated portraits depicted explicit or suggestive imagery, even when the input selfies were innocuous. This unintended behavior has raised concerns about the app's suitability for a general audience and sparked discussions about the responsibilities of AI developers in mitigating potential risks. The root cause of Lensa AI's NSFW generation lies in the intricacies of its machine learning model. The app employs a deep learning architecture, specifically a variant of Generative Adversarial Networks (GANs), to create stylized portraits. GANs consist of two neural networks: a generator and a discriminator, which work in tandem to produce realistic images. However, the training data used to develop Lensa AI's model may have inadvertently included NSFW content. When the generator network encounters ambiguous or noisy input, it can sometimes produce outputs that resemble NSFW imagery, even if the original selfie was not explicit. This phenomenon, known as "mode collapse" or "overfitting," is a common challenge in GAN-based systems.

Ethical Implications and User Concerns

The emergence of NSFW content in Lensa AI-generated portraits raises several ethical concerns: 1. User Consent and Autonomy: Users may feel violated or misrepresented when their selfies are transformed into NSFW images without their explicit consent. This breach of trust can undermine the user experience and erode confidence in AI technologies. 2. Content Moderation and Filtering: The lack of robust content moderation mechanisms in Lensa AI highlights the challenges of regulating AI-generated content. Developers must implement effective filtering systems to prevent the dissemination of inappropriate material, especially in applications accessible to minors. 3. Bias and Stereotyping: The NSFW generation may perpetuate harmful stereotypes or biases present in the training data. If the model has been exposed to biased or discriminatory content, it could inadvertently reinforce these prejudices in its outputs. 4. Legal and Regulatory Compliance: The distribution of NSFW content, particularly involving minors or non-consenting individuals, can have severe legal repercussions. Developers must ensure compliance with relevant laws and regulations, such as the Children's Online Privacy Protection Act (COPPA) and the General Data Protection Regulation (GDPR).

Addressing the NSFW Issue: Technical and Ethical Solutions

To mitigate the NSFW controversy, Prisma Labs and the AI community at large can adopt several strategies: Enhancing the quality and diversity of training data is crucial to reducing NSFW generation. Developers should implement rigorous data filtering processes to exclude explicit or inappropriate content. Additionally, incorporating more representative and inclusive datasets can help minimize biases and stereotypes. Implementing sophisticated content moderation systems can enable real-time detection and filtering of NSFW content. Techniques such as image recognition, natural language processing, and machine learning-based classifiers can be employed to identify and flag potentially inappropriate images. Empowering users to report NSFW or offensive content is essential for continuous improvement. Lensa AI can introduce user-friendly reporting features, allowing individuals to flag problematic images and provide feedback. This feedback loop can help developers refine their models and address emerging issues promptly. Promoting transparency about Lensa AI's capabilities and limitations can foster user understanding and trust. Developers should provide clear explanations of the app's functionality, potential risks, and the measures taken to mitigate NSFW generation. Educating users about responsible AI usage and the importance of consent can also contribute to a more informed and ethical user base. The AI community should collaborate to establish best practices and industry standards for NSFW content moderation. Joint research initiatives, knowledge sharing, and the development of open-source tools can accelerate progress in addressing this challenge. By working together, developers can create more robust and ethical AI systems.
